ND vs WF Weather And Pitch Report
Factors | Expected Condition |
---|---|
Weather | Partly sunny |
Pitch | Pacer Friendly |
Weather - According to AccuWeather, the weather will be breezy and pleasant with intervals of sunshine and clouds . The temperature will be in-between 24°C-13°C and there is 25% chance of rain during the game.
Pitch Report- The surface at Seddon Park is renowned for being a bowler’s paradise, especially favoring seamers who can make the most of the conditions with the new ball. In the initial phases of the match, bowlers are likely to extract considerable movement and lively bounce, posing a stern challenge to the batters. However, as the game unfolds, the pitch is expected to ease out, gradually transitioning into a more batting-friendly track, offering players the chance to capitalize and demonstrate their prowess with the bat.
Seddon Park, Hamilton - Record of Chasing Teams in T20s
Out of 11 T20 matches that have been played at Seddon Park so far, the chasing side has won only 3 games; the skipper winning the toss might prefer to bat first on this ground depending upon the past records.
